OpenClaw:重新定义个人AI代理的技术演进与实践

一、从实验室到开源生态:OpenClaw的进化轨迹

2024年12月,某技术社区出现了一款名为Clawd的AI代理原型,其核心开发者在博客中首次披露了基于TypeScript构建的模块化架构。这款采用”机械龙虾”图标的工具,通过分解复杂任务为可执行的原子操作,实现了跨软件交互的突破性进展。开发者公布的配置代码显示,其采用分层设计模式:底层依赖操作系统级API调用,中间层封装应用交互协议,顶层提供自然语言解析引擎。

2025年1月,项目完成关键技术迭代并更名为OpenClaw,标志着从封闭开发向开源生态的转型。其技术白皮书揭示了三大创新点:1)基于向量数据库的长期记忆系统;2)支持多智能体协同的工作流引擎;3)硬件友好的轻量化部署方案。这些特性使其在GitHub开源首周即获得超5000个Star,成为当年最受关注的AI基础设施项目之一。

二、技术架构深度解析

1. 核心组件构成

OpenClaw采用微内核架构,主要包含四个模块:

  • 感知层:通过OCR识别、屏幕截图解析和API监听获取环境状态
  • 决策层:基于React式编程模型的事件处理系统,支持条件分支和循环控制
  • 执行层:封装了300+个应用操作原语,涵盖浏览器自动化、IDE操作等场景
  • 记忆层:采用双数据库架构,短期记忆使用Redis,长期记忆基于Chroma向量库
  1. // 示例:邮件处理工作流配置
  2. const emailWorkflow = {
  3. triggers: ["new_email@inbox"],
  4. steps: [
  5. { action: "extract_sender", params: { field: "from" } },
  6. {
  7. action: "classify_priority",
  8. condition: (ctx) => ctx.sender.includes("manager@company.com")
  9. },
  10. { action: "move_to_folder", params: { folder: "Urgent" } }
  11. ]
  12. }

2. 跨平台交互实现

项目团队创新性地将即时通讯工具转化为控制终端:

  • 协议适配层:通过WebSocket建立安全通道,支持WhatsApp、Slack等平台的消息中继
  • 自然语言解析:采用BERT变体模型实现意图识别,准确率达92%
  • 会话管理:维护上下文状态机,支持多轮对话和任务中断恢复

在Mac mini部署方案中,测试数据显示其CPU占用率稳定在15%以下,内存消耗不超过500MB,这得益于对Apple Silicon架构的专项优化。开发者特别设计了硬件抽象层,使得同一套代码可在x86和ARM架构间无缝迁移。

三、典型应用场景实践

1. 自动化办公套件

某金融企业基于OpenClaw构建的智能助手,实现了:

  • 每日自动处理2000+封邮件,分类准确率98.7%
  • 会议纪要生成时间从45分钟缩短至8分钟
  • 跨系统数据同步误差率低于0.03%

关键实现技术包括:

  • 多模态输入处理:融合语音、文本和图像信息的统一解析框架
  • 异常处理机制:当API调用失败时自动切换备用方案
  • 审计日志系统:记录所有操作轨迹满足合规要求

2. 开发辅助系统

在代码生成场景中,OpenClaw展现出独特优势:

  • 支持12种主流编程语言的上下文感知补全
  • 可自动生成单元测试用例,覆盖率达85%+
  • 跨仓库依赖管理准确率行业领先

某开源项目维护者分享的数据显示,引入该工具后:

  • PR处理效率提升300%
  • 新贡献者上手时间从2周缩短至3天
  • 代码规范违规率下降76%

四、云端部署最佳实践

主流云服务商提供的极简部署方案包含三个核心组件:

  1. 镜像市场:预装OpenClaw环境的容器镜像,支持一键拉取
  2. 工作流编排:可视化拖拽式任务设计器,降低使用门槛
  3. 智能运维:基于Prometheus的监控告警系统,支持自动扩缩容

典型部署流程如下:

  1. # 容器化部署示例
  2. docker pull openclaw/base:latest
  3. docker run -d --name openclaw-agent \
  4. -e WHATSAPP_TOKEN=your_token \
  5. -v /data/memory:/app/memory \
  6. openclaw/base

性能优化建议:

  • 内存配置:建议不低于4GB,处理复杂任务时推荐8GB+
  • 存储选择:SSD比HDD在向量检索场景下快5-8倍
  • 网络要求:与目标应用服务同区域部署可降低延迟

五、开源生态与未来演进

2026年项目转入基金会管理模式后,形成由核心开发者、企业贡献者和社区用户组成的三层治理结构。当前维护着三个主要分支:

  • 稳定版:每季度发布,经过严格测试
  • 开发版:每周更新,包含最新特性
  • 企业版:提供SLA保障和专属支持

技术路线图显示,2027年将重点突破:

  1. 多模态大模型集成
  2. 边缘计算场景优化
  3. 隐私计算增强方案

对于开发者而言,现在正是参与贡献的最佳时机。项目提供清晰的贡献指南,从文档改进到核心模块开发均有明确路径。每月举办的线上Hackathon已成为技术交流的重要平台,优秀方案有机会被整合到官方发行版中。

结语:OpenClaw的崛起标志着个人AI代理进入实用化阶段。其模块化设计、跨平台能力和活跃的开源生态,正在重新定义人机协作的边界。无论是个人开发者探索自动化可能,还是企业构建智能中台,这个项目都提供了值得借鉴的技术范式和实践路径。